Nelspruit, or Mbombela, is Mpumalanga’s capital and a hub for tourism and agriculture. The city offers flexible part-time and weekend jobs in industries like retail, hospitality, education, healthcare, and transportation, catering to students, parents, and those seeking extra income across various skill levels.

Retail Jobs in Nelspruit

Job Overview: Retail jobs are among the most common part-time opportunities in Nelspruit, especially in malls and shopping centers like i’langa Mall and Riverside Mall. Positions include sales assistants, cashiers, and stock clerks. Weekend shifts are in high demand, particularly during busy shopping periods.

Monthly Salaries for Retail Jobs: Retail workers in Nelspruit typically earn between ZAR 3,500 and ZAR 6,500 per month, depending on the number of hours worked and the employer.

Requirements for Retail Jobs: A high school diploma and good communication skills are generally required. Experience in customer service or retail is an advantage, but many stores offer entry-level positions.

Hospitality and Tourism Jobs in Nelspruit

Job Overview: Tourism is a key industry in Nelspruit due to its proximity to the Kruger National Park. Part-time jobs in hospitality are available in hotels, lodges, restaurants, and guesthouses. Common roles include waiters, bartenders, receptionists, kitchen assistants, and tour guides. Weekend shifts are especially popular during peak tourist seasons.

Monthly Salaries for Hospitality Jobs: Hospitality workers typically earn between ZAR 4,000 and ZAR 7,000 per month. Waiters and bartenders may earn additional income through tips.

Requirements for Hospitality Jobs: Experience in customer service is helpful, but not always required for entry-level positions. Flexibility to work weekends and evenings is often necessary, especially during busy periods. Bartenders may need certification to serve alcohol.

Freelancing and Remote Work

Job Overview: Freelancing and remote work are increasingly popular options in Nelspruit, especially for individuals with skills in areas like graphic design, content writing, social media management, and virtual assistance. Freelancers can work part-time from home, offering services to clients locally or internationally.

Monthly Earnings Potential: Freelancers in Nelspruit can earn between ZAR 5,000 and ZAR 20,000 per month, depending on their skill level, client base, and workload.

Requirements for Freelance Jobs: A strong portfolio and proficiency in specific software or tools related to your field are essential for freelancing. Freelancers need access to a reliable internet connection and good time management skills to juggle multiple projects.

Education and Tutoring Jobs

Job Overview: The education sector in Nelspruit offers part-time tutoring opportunities for students who need extra help in subjects like math, science, and languages. Tutors can work on weekends or after school hours, offering both in-person and online tutoring sessions.

Monthly Salaries for Tutors: Tutors typically earn between ZAR 2,500 and ZAR 6,000 per month, depending on the number of students and hours worked.

Qualifications and Requirements for Tutoring Jobs: A good understanding of the subject being taught is necessary. Some tutoring roles may require formal teaching qualifications, while others are open to university students or recent graduates with expertise in specific subjects.

Healthcare and Social Work Jobs

Job Overview: Healthcare is a growing sector in Nelspruit, and part-time jobs are available in clinics, hospitals, and care homes. Positions such as caregivers, nursing assistants, and social workers are often needed on weekends to support patient care and provide community services.

Monthly Salaries for Healthcare Jobs: Caregivers and nursing assistants typically earn between ZAR 4,000 and ZAR 8,000 per month. Nurses can earn more, depending on their qualifications and experience.

Requirements for Healthcare Jobs: Formal qualifications such as caregiving or nursing certificates are required for most healthcare roles. Social workers must hold a degree in social work and be registered with the South African Council for Social Service Professions (SACSSP).

Transportation and Delivery Jobs

Job Overview: With the rise of food delivery services and ride-hailing platforms, part-time driving jobs are in demand in Nelspruit. You can work as a driver for Uber or Bolt, or deliver food for services like Mr D Food or Uber Eats. These jobs offer flexible hours, particularly during weekends when demand is higher.

Monthly Earnings for Transportation Jobs: Drivers and delivery workers typically earn between ZAR 5,000 and ZAR 10,000 per month, depending on hours worked and demand for services.

Requirements for Transportation Jobs: A valid driver’s license and access to a reliable vehicle are essential. Ride-hailing drivers may also need a Professional Driving Permit (PDP).

Agriculture and Farm Work

Job Overview: Mpumalanga is known for its agriculture, and part-time jobs in this sector are available in Nelspruit. Jobs may include fruit picking, packing, and general farm work, particularly during planting and harvesting seasons. These jobs are often available on weekends.

Monthly Salaries for Agriculture Jobs: Farmworkers typically earn between ZAR 3,000 and ZAR 6,000 per month, depending on the type of work and hours involved.

Requirements for Agriculture Jobs: Physical fitness and the ability to work outdoors are essential. Experience with farming or agriculture can be helpful but is not always necessary for entry-level roles.

Salaries for Part-Time and Weekend Jobs in Nelspruit

Salaries for part-time and weekend jobs in Nelspruit vary depending on the industry and number of hours worked. Below is a general overview of the salary ranges:

  • Retail Jobs: ZAR 3,500 to ZAR 6,500 per month
  • Hospitality Jobs: ZAR 4,000 to ZAR 7,000 per month (plus tips for waiters and bartenders)
  • Freelance and Remote Jobs: ZAR 5,000 to ZAR 20,000 per month, depending on skills and workload
  • Tutoring Jobs: ZAR 2,500 to ZAR 6,000 per month
  • Healthcare Jobs: ZAR 4,000 to ZAR 8,000 per month (nurses may earn more)
  • Transportation Jobs: ZAR 5,000 to ZAR 10,000 per month
  • Agriculture Jobs: ZAR 3,000 to ZAR 6,000 per month

Where to Find Part-Time and Weekend Jobs in Nelspruit

  • Job Portals: Websites like Indeed, Gumtree, and CareerJunction list part-time job opportunities in Nelspruit.
  • Local Newspapers: Check local classifieds for job listings, especially in sectors like retail and hospitality.
  • Recruitment Agencies: Agencies that specialize in temporary or part-time work can help match you with employers looking for flexible workers.
  • Networking: Building connections in your local community can help you find job opportunities that may not be widely advertised.

Tips for Securing a Part-Time or Weekend Job in Nelspruit

  • Tailor Your CV: Highlight relevant skills and experience for the part-time role you are applying for.
  • Be Flexible: Employers in sectors like hospitality and retail often look for workers who can be available for irregular hours, including evenings and weekends.
  • Network Locally: Reach out to local businesses, friends, and family to discover job openings that may not be posted online.
